As I understand it. The WB is merging with the UPN and they will be known as the CW (thankfully, it wasn't the WC [Water Closet]!). So that's UPN+WB=CW (http://money.cnn.com/2006/01/24/news/companies/cbs_warner/index.htm). And all of this happens next September. Thankfully, one of my favorite shows, Gilmore Girls, from the WB will be on the CW. BTW, the 'C' stands for CBS which is another broadcast network in the US and controlled UPN; and the 'W' still stands for Warner Brothers.
Now in that article I linked, they say Veronica Mars will still be a show on the new network. But I have heard elsewhere that Veronica Mars is on the bubble. But maybe with the merger it might get new legs. Oddly enough more people at the CNN poll concerning the new network say they will be less likely to watch the new CW rather than the old WB or UPN.
